On this episode of Dangerous Creatives, Kristin is joined by entrepreneur Lauren Gish and they discuss their self employed/entrepreneur journeys through their experience with autoimmune disease and chronic illness. They chat about how leaving their full time jobs to go freelance was a health related decision, and what the challenges were once they were a solo entrepreneur or running a team of their own. From sharing systems and boundaries they've put into place, to hiring a team and building a network from your "competition" to add in extra support, both women share what's worked well for them in their career so far.

Lauren Gish is a Chicago native, southern transplant, business owner, mom and lover of stand up comedy. Her career has spanned a wide array of industries from beauty distribution, education, business management, and some time in the music industry. She founded her consulting company- The Ownership Mindset in 2019. It was founded out of a desire to see other women empowered, rather than overwhelmed by their businesses. Streamlining operations, creating environments that bring the best people, and finding profit are her favorite things to do. She also owns Fruition Salon in Nashville, TN.
